Why the Right Case Matters for Reading

It might seem simple, but the case you use for your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o plays a significant role in your reading comfort. Holding a tablet directly can be awkward. Your hands can get tired, you might strain your wrists, and there’s always the risk of dropping it. A good case solves these problems by:
- Providing Stability: A case with a built-in stand keeps your tablet upright on a flat surface, freeing your hands.
- Ergonomic Design: Some cases are designed to be more comfortable to hold for longer periods, even without using the stand function.
- Protecting Your Investment: While not directly related to reading comfort, knowing your tablet is safe allows you to relax and focus on your content.
- Adjustable Viewing Angles: The best cases allow you to adjust the tilt of your tablet, finding the perfect angle to reduce glare and neck strain.
When considering the RCA Tablet 11 Galileo, its case is often designed with versatility in mind. Many models feature a folio style with an integrated stand. This makes it an ideal accessory for transforming your tablet into an e-reader.
Understanding the RCA Tablet 11 Galileo Case Features for Reading

The RCA Tablet 11 Galileo case typically comes with features that are particularly beneficial for reading. Let’s break down what to look for and how to use them:
Integrated Stand Functionality
This is arguably the most crucial feature for effortless reading. Most RCA Tablet 11 Galileo cases are folio-style, meaning they fold over the screen for protection. This front cover often has grooves or a folding design that allows you to prop the tablet up at various angles.
- How to Use It: Unfold the front cover. You’ll usually find indentations or a way to fold the cover back against itself to create stable viewing angles. Experiment with different positions to find what works best for you in various settings – on a desk, a coffee table, or even your lap.
- Benefits for Reading:
- Hands-free operation.
- Reduces arm and wrist fatigue.
- Consistent viewing angle minimizes glare.
- Allows for a more natural posture while reading.
Material and Grip
The material of your case affects both durability and how comfortable it is to hold. For reading, a case with a good grip is important, even if you’re not holding it constantly. If you do decide to hold it, a textured or slightly soft material can make a big difference.
- Common Materials: Many RCA Tablet 11 Galileo cases are made from synthetic leather (polyurethane) or durable plastics.
- Grip Enhancement: Look for cases with a matte finish or a subtle texture. These are less likely to slip from your hands or off surfaces.
- Cleaning: A smooth, wipeable surface is also a plus for maintaining hygiene, especially if you share your tablet or eat while reading.
Full Access to Ports and Buttons
An excellent reading case shouldn’t hinder your access to the tablet’s functionalities. You need to be able to easily turn pages (virtually or by swiping), adjust volume, and charge your device without removing the case.
- Precise Cutouts: Ensure your case has precise cutouts for the charging port, headphone jack (if applicable), power button, volume controls, and cameras.
- Ease of Use: You should be able to plug in your charger or headphones without fumbling or removing the tablet from its case.
Screen Protection and Auto Sleep/Wake
While not directly about holding the tablet, protecting your screen and having smart features contribute to a seamless reading experience.
- Screen Coverage: The folio design protects your tablet’s screen from scratches when not in use.
- Auto Sleep/Wake: Many cases automatically put the tablet to sleep when closed and wake it up when opened. This saves battery life and means you can start reading immediately without pressing a button each time.
Setting Up Your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o for Optimal Reading

Transforming your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o into a reading machine is straightforward with its case. Here’s how to get the most out of it.
Step-by-Step Stand Setup
Most RCA Tablet 11 Galileo cases are designed for ease of use. Follow these general steps:
- Open the Case: Lay your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o flat, screen-side up. Open the folio cover completely.
- Identify the Stand Mechanism: Look for the indentations or fold lines on the inside of the front cover. These are designed to lock the cover into different positions.
- Choose Your Angle: Gently fold the front cover back. You’ll typically find a few grooves that allow you to slot the cover edge into, creating an upright position. Start with a steeper angle, similar to a laptop screen.
- Adjust and Test: Place the tablet on a stable surface. Adjust the angle until you find a comfortable viewing position that minimizes glare from your surroundings and allows you to read without straining your neck.
- Positioning: Place the tablet in front of you on a desk, table, or lap tray. This frees your hands to relax, turn pages with a swipe, or take notes.
Optimizing Your Reading Environment
Even with the perfect setup, your environment matters. Consider these points:
- Lighting: Position your tablet to avoid direct glare from windows or overhead lights. The adjustable stand helps immensely here. Reading under natural daylight is often preferred, but if that causes glare, opt for indirect artificial light.
- Comfortable Seating: Use the stand on a comfortable chair or sofa. Think about how you would position a physical book for maximum comfort.
- Ergonomics: Ensure the tablet is at eye level as much as possible. This prevents neck strain from looking down for too long.
Choosing the Right Reading App
The app you use can also enhance your reading experience. For the RCA Tablet 11 Galileo, consider apps that offer:
- Adjustable Font Sizes and Styles: Crucial for comfortable reading, especially for those with visual impairments.
- Background Customization: Options like sepia tones or dark modes can reduce eye strain, particularly in low light.
- Page Turn Animations: Some readers prefer a subtle page-turning animation for a more book-like feel.
- Note-Taking and Highlighting: If you’re reading for study or research, these features are invaluable.
Popular reading apps like Kindle, Google Play Books, and Kobo offer robust customization options. For articles, apps like Pocket or Instapaper allow you to save content and read it later in a distraction-free format.

Tips for Maintaining Your Case
To ensure your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o case continues to provide effortless reading for a long time, here are a few maintenance t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Wipe the exterior and interior of the case with a soft, damp cloth. For tougher marks, use a mild soap solution and then wipe with a clean, damp cloth. Avoid harsh chemicals.
- Keep it Dry: Protect the case from excessive moisture, which can damage synthetic materials and affect its structural integrity.
- Handle the Stand Gently: While designed for frequent use, avoid forcing the stand into positions or bending it beyond its intended range.
- Avoid Extreme Temperatures: Prolonged exposure to direct sunlight or extreme cold can degrade the material over time.
Troubleshooting Common Case Issues
Even the best cases can sometimes have minor issues. Here are a few common problems and their solutions:
-
Tablet Not Staying Upright:
- Cause: Worn grooves, or the cover material has become too flexible.
- Solution: Try using different grooves if available. If significantly worn, you might need to consider a replacement case or a separate tablet stand. Ensure the tablet isn’t too heavy for the case’s stand mechanism.
-
Buttons Are Hard to Press:
- Cause: Misaligned button cutouts or a tight fit.
- Solution: Gently try to adjust the tablet within the case. If the issue persists, the case might not be perfectly molded for your specific tablet model, or there might be a defect.
-
Screen Not Waking/Sleeping:
- Cause: The magnets in the case are misaligned with the tablet’s sensors, or the feature is disabled in your tablet’s settings.
- Solution: Check your RCA Tablet 11 Galileo’s settings under “Display” or “Battery” to ensure the auto sleep/wake function is enabled. Try removing the tablet from the case and reinserting it to ensure proper magnet alignment.
-
Case Cover Flaps Open:
- Cause: The elastic closure (if present) is stretched, or the magnetic clasp is weak.
- Solution: If there’s an elastic band, you might need to be more careful when handling it. For magnetic clasps, ensure no other metallic objects are interfering. A worn clasp might require a new case.
